General Information about #2A401E
The hexadecimal color code #2a401e represents a dark shade of green, often associated with nature, earth, and stability. It is part of the broader green color family, falling within the range of olive and forest greens. In the RGB color model, it is composed of 16.47% red, 25.1% green, and 11.76% blue. This color is most commonly perceived as a muted, subdued tone, lending itself well to applications where a subtle and understated aesthetic is desired. Its relative darkness means that it is often used as an accent or background color rather than a primary hue. The color's earthy qualities make it particularly suitable for designs aiming to evoke feelings of calm, naturalness, and reliability. In CMYK color model the color is composed of C:0.34 M:0.00 Y:0.53 K:0.75.
The hex color #2a401e, also known as Rangitoto, presents some accessibility challenges, particularly concerning color contrast. When used as a background color, it requires careful selection of foreground text colors to ensure readability. A light text color, such as white (#ffffff) or a very pale shade of yellow or green, would be necessary to meet WCAG (Web Content Accessibility Guidelines) standards for contrast ratios. Conversely, if used as a text color, a very light background is crucial. Using tools like a color contrast checker is highly recommended to verify that the combination passes accessibility standards. Consider that individuals with visual impairments, such as low vision or color blindness, may struggle to distinguish elements using this color against darker backgrounds. Providing alternative visual cues, like borders or icons, can further improve accessibility. The specific needs of the target audience should also be considered when evaluating accessibility.

Web Design
In web design, #2a401e can be utilized for creating a natural, earthy aesthetic. It is suitable for backgrounds, borders, or accents on websites related to nature, environmentalism, or organic products. The color evokes a sense of calm and tranquility, which can be beneficial for websites aiming to promote relaxation or wellness. When used sparingly, it can add a touch of sophistication and uniqueness to the design. However, care must be taken to ensure sufficient contrast with text and other elements for optimal readability and user experience. Consider its application in website footers or as a subtle background element to provide visual interest without overwhelming the user.
Interior Design
In interior design, #2a401e can be used to create a cozy and inviting atmosphere, especially when paired with lighter, warmer colors. It works well in living rooms or bedrooms, where a sense of relaxation is desired. This color can be incorporated through wall paint, furniture upholstery, or decorative accessories. It complements natural materials like wood and stone, enhancing the earthy feel. It also fits well in spaces where you want to bring a biophilic aspect to the interior. Consider using it in accent walls or to complement other design elements.
Fashion
In fashion, #2a401e can be a great alternative to traditional neutral colors like black or gray. It can be used in clothing items such as jackets, pants, or dresses, offering a subtle yet stylish look. This color pairs well with earth tones like beige, brown, and olive green, creating a harmonious and nature-inspired outfit. It can also be combined with brighter colors like mustard yellow or burnt orange for a bolder and more eye-catching ensemble. This color can also work as an elegant accent color for accessories.
